Your source says, "Contrary to what some sources say, acronyms do not have to be pronounceable words (for example FBI is spelled out when spoken, whereas NASA is not). Some sources use the word initialism to refer to the spelled acronyms." Said "other" sources (dictionary.com, WordNet, American Heritage Dictionary) indicate that an acronym DOES in fact spell out a pronounceable word, "acronym...n : a word formed from the initial letters of a multi-word name" *shrug* [ http://dictionary.reference.com/search?q=acronym ] Internet wars! ;-) SS
